Trait RequestId

Source
pub trait RequestId {
    // Required method
    fn request_id(&self) -> Option<&str>;
}
Expand description

Implementers add a function to return an AWS request ID

Required Methods§

Source

fn request_id(&self) -> Option<&str>

Returns the request ID, or None if the service could not be reached.

Implementations on Foreign Types§

Source§

impl RequestId for Headers

Source§

impl<B> RequestId for Response<B>

Source§

impl<E> RequestId for SdkError<E, Response>

Source§

impl<O, E> RequestId for Result<O, E>
where O: RequestId, E: RequestId,

Implementors§

Source§

impl RequestId for Error

Source§

impl RequestId for CopyBackupToRegionError

Source§

impl RequestId for CreateClusterError

Source§

impl RequestId for CreateHsmError

Source§

impl RequestId for DeleteBackupError

Source§

impl RequestId for DeleteClusterError

Source§

impl RequestId for DeleteHsmError

Source§

impl RequestId for DeleteResourcePolicyError

Source§

impl RequestId for DescribeBackupsError

Source§

impl RequestId for DescribeClustersError

Source§

impl RequestId for GetResourcePolicyError

Source§

impl RequestId for InitializeClusterError

Source§

impl RequestId for ListTagsError

Source§

impl RequestId for ModifyBackupAttributesError

Source§

impl RequestId for ModifyClusterError

Source§

impl RequestId for PutResourcePolicyError

Source§

impl RequestId for RestoreBackupError

Source§

impl RequestId for TagResourceError

Source§

impl RequestId for UntagResourceError

Source§

impl RequestId for ErrorMetadata

Source§

impl RequestId for CloudHsmAccessDeniedException

Source§

impl RequestId for CloudHsmInternalFailureException

Source§

impl RequestId for CloudHsmInvalidRequestException

Source§

impl RequestId for CloudHsmResourceLimitExceededException

Source§

impl RequestId for CloudHsmResourceNotFoundException

Source§

impl RequestId for CloudHsmServiceException

Source§

impl RequestId for CloudHsmTagException

Source§

impl RequestId for CopyBackupToRegionOutput

Source§

impl RequestId for CreateClusterOutput

Source§

impl RequestId for CreateHsmOutput

Source§

impl RequestId for DeleteBackupOutput

Source§

impl RequestId for DeleteClusterOutput

Source§

impl RequestId for DeleteHsmOutput

Source§

impl RequestId for DeleteResourcePolicyOutput

Source§

impl RequestId for DescribeBackupsOutput

Source§

impl RequestId for DescribeClustersOutput

Source§

impl RequestId for GetResourcePolicyOutput

Source§

impl RequestId for InitializeClusterOutput

Source§

impl RequestId for ListTagsOutput

Source§

impl RequestId for ModifyBackupAttributesOutput

Source§

impl RequestId for ModifyClusterOutput

Source§

impl RequestId for PutResourcePolicyOutput

Source§

impl RequestId for RestoreBackupOutput

Source§

impl RequestId for TagResourceOutput

Source§

impl RequestId for UntagResourceOutput